- Title
Combination of lateral ventricular puncture and catheterization with different doses of urokinase in the treatment of ventricular hemorrhage under CT multimodal imaging.
- Authors
Zhifu Song; Yulan Gan; Xueping Huang; Xiaolin Huang; Gonghong Liu; Bing Kong; Wenyou Wu
- Abstract
Purpose: To study the clinical effectiveness of lateral ventricular puncture and catheterization in combination with urokinase in the treatment of intraventricular hemorrhage (IVH) under computed tomography (CT) multimodal imaging. Methods: Eighty-four IVH patients were selected and assigned to high- and low-dose urokinase groups. The clinical efficacy of the combination of lateral ventricle puncture and drainage at different doses of urokinase under CT multimodal imaging in the treatment of IVH, was determined. Results: Compared with the low-dose urokinase group, postoperative waking time, postoperative extubation time and discharge time in the high-dose group were markedly better in high-dose urokinase group, while GCS score after treatment was lower in the high-dose group, with higher total effectiveness in the high-dose urokinase group. There was a significantly higher hematoma clearance in the highdose group on the 3rd day of treatment (p < 0.001), while the total incidence of postoperative complications were markedly lower in the high-dose group (p < 0.05). Conclusion: The combination of lateral ventricular puncture and drainage with high-dose urokinase under CT multimodal imaging enhances the recovery of consciousness in IVH patients. Therefore, the combined treatment has great potentials for clinical application.
